πŸ“› Title The "insightful portfolio" freelance project showcase platform 🏷️ Tags πŸ‘₯ Team: 1-5 πŸŽ“ Domain Expertise Required: Design, Product Management πŸ“ Scale: Local to National πŸ“Š Venture Scale: Seed to Series A 🌍 Market: Niche (Freelance Services) 🌐 Global Potential: Moderate ⏱ Timing: Now 🧾 Regulatory Tailwind: Low πŸ“ˆ Emerging Trend: Freelance Market Growth ✨ Highlights: User-friendly design, strong differentiation πŸš€ Intro Paragraph Freelancers struggle to showcase their work effectively. This platform enables them to present curated portfolios tailored to specific gigs, tapping into the growing freelance market. Monetization through subscription fees or transaction cuts is straightforward. πŸ” Search Trend Section Keyword: "freelance portfolio" Volume: 33.5K Growth: +220% πŸ“Š Opportunity Scores Opportunity: 8/10 Problem: 7/10 Feasibility: 6/10 Why Now: 9/10 πŸ’΅ Business Fit (Scorecard) Category Answer πŸ’° Revenue Potential: $1M–$5M ARR πŸ”§ Execution Difficulty: 7/10 – Moderate complexity πŸš€ Go-To-Market: 8/10 – Organic growth via social media ⏱ Why Now? The freelance economy is booming, with more professionals seeking to differentiate themselves online. Increased digital engagement and remote work have accelerated this trend. βœ… Proof & Signals Keyword trends: Strong growth in freelance-related searches. Reddit buzz: Frequent discussions in freelance forums. Market exits: Recent acquisitions of portfolio platforms indicate strong interest. 🧩 The Market Gap Freelancers lack a cohesive way to present their work that stands out to potential clients. Current platforms are cluttered and generic, failing to address individual branding needs. 🎯 Target Persona Demographics: 25-40-year-old freelancers in creative industries. Habits: Active on social media, regular portfolio updates. Pain: Difficulty in capturing attention and showing unique skills. Discovery: Primarily through social networks or freelance job boards. πŸ’‘ Solution The Idea: A platform where freelancers can build personalized portfolios easily. How It Works: Users select templates and upload projects; the platform generates a shareable link. Go-To-Market Strategy: Launch with a focus on creative communities (Instagram, design forums) and leverage influencer partnerships for credibility. Business Model: - Subscription - Transaction fees for premium features Startup Costs: Medium Break down: Product (Development), Team (Marketing, Support), GTM (Launch Campaign), Legal (Terms of Service) πŸ†š Competition & Differentiation Competitors: Behance, Dribbble, Upwork Portfolio Intensity: High Differentiators: Unique templates, tailored branding options, user-friendly interface. ⚠️ Execution & Risk Time to market: Medium Risk areas: Technical (platform stability), Trust (user data security) Critical assumptions: Users will find value in premium features. πŸ’° Monetization Potential Rate: High Why: Strong LTV due to upsell potential on premium features and high user engagement. 🧠 Founder Fit Ideal for someone with a background in design and product management, deeply understanding freelancer needs. 🧭 Exit Strategy & Growth Vision Likely exits: Acquisition by larger freelance platforms or SaaS companies.
